Easy to store

Foldable cheap treadmills are more compact than full-size treadmills and can be folded away when not in use. This is a great feature for those with smaller homes or apartments, and wish to conserve space in their workout area. Some treadmills can be placed under beds or in a closet making them a great option for those with limited storage space.

When you're looking for a treadmill that folds be sure to verify the maximum speed and the incline settings. Most treadmills can only reach the maximum speed of 10 miles per hour, however certain models can go up to 12 miles per hour and have an incline up to 15 percent. If you're planning to run or walk at a more speed, ensure that the treadmill you choose can take your weight as well as any extra weight (such a weighted vest or ankle weights).

Lubricating the decks and belts is the first step to maintaining your treadmill's folding capabilities. This is a simple job and most manufacturers provide instructions on how to do it. Check the tension of the belt. It should be tight enough to hold the belt, but not too tight that it causes slipping or buckling.

Sometimes, your treadmill could emit a noxious burning smell. This is usually an indication that something is wrong with the motor. It could be something as simple as a burned out wire or loose cord, but it could be more serious. It's better to call a professional to fix a motor that is burned out than risk injury or further damage.

If you notice that the speed of your treadmill is varying, it might be time to replace the belt. This is typically caused by a worn or damaged belt. In addition to replacing the belt, you must also clean and lubricate your treadmill frequently to ensure that it's functioning properly.

To do this, you'll have remove the foot rails. The screws are held in by Phillips-head screw heads that can be removed with an Allen wrench. After removing the foot rails you can access the roller screws that keep the belt in position. They are located on either side of belt and must be loosened to reveal the rollers beneath.
